Harnessing its Power of Red Light for Cellular Regeneration
Red light therapy has gained considerable recognition in recent years as a potential treatment for promoting cellular regeneration. This non-invasive approach involves exposing the body to wavelengths of red light, which are believed to enhance cellular processes at a fundamental level. Research suggests that red light therapy can affect mitochondria, the powerhouses of cells, by increasing ATP production and minimizing oxidative stress. This enhanced energy production can lead to improved cell activity, tissue repair, and overall fitness.
Red light therapy has been explored for a wide range of ailments, including wound healing, skin rejuvenation, pain management, and even cognitive enhancement. While more in-depth research is needed to fully understand the mechanisms and applications of red light therapy, its potential benefits are impressive.

Red Light Therapy Explained: A Look at Its Scientific Basis
Red light phototherapy employs wavelengths of light in the red spectrum to stimulate cellular function. This non-invasive treatment has gained attention for its potential effects in a variety of areas, including wound healing, skin improvement, and pain management. The underlying principles by which red light therapy operates are complex and include the absorption of light energy by cellular structures, leading to increased generation of ATP, the body's primary fuel source.
- Furthermore, red light therapy has been shown to reduce inflammation and oxidative stress, contributing to its therapeutic effectiveness.
